Welcome to The Cove, the only luxury dockside rental community of its kind.

Floating atop the Cape Fear River in Historic Downtown Wilmington, our roomy villas blur the lines between home and boat, offering an unparalleled fusion of comfort and adventure.

Safety

Nearby lake/river

Our villas are securely tied to a floating dock, which does not have railings. There are railings on the front and upstairs patio/balconies, and kids should be supervised at all times while in the marina. Swimming is not allowed in the Cape Fear River due to the dangerous current.

Potential for noise

Located next-door to Marina Grille & Live Oak Bank Amphitheater, live music can often be heard from our dock and patios. Military planes are also often heard flying overhead during the day. Guests have noted however, that our villas are very well insulated and stay peaceful inside.

Wilmington rental home booking tips and tricks:

Getting the best rental value:

  • June, July, and August are the most expensive months along the coast of NC. Reserve your Southport rental home in the Spring or Fall to get the benefit of warm we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ities.
  • Reserve your rental as early as possible. Rental schedules generally become available a year in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many families reserve their Summer rentals during Winter holiday gatherings.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ective vacation rental company or host whether your group qualifies for a price reduction.
  • Booking websites frequently offer customers an option to buy trip insurance. Trip insurance, which will generally cost anywhere between 1% - 5% of the boo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any days missed as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ance might be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for more information.
